Form 4: Benchmark Electronics CLO Receives Equity Awards
Insider Transaction Report
Benchmark Electronics' SVP, General Counsel, and CLO, Stephen J. Beaver, reported the acquisition of restricted stock units and performance-based awards, alongside a tax-related share disposition.
Summary
- Stephen J. Beaver, SVP, General Counsel and CLO of Benchmark Electronics Inc. (BHE), reported transactions on February 20, 2026.
- Acquired 10,278 shares of Common Stock through a restricted stock unit (RSU) award, scheduled to vest in ratable installments over a three-year period from the grant date.
- Acquired an additional 6,424 shares of Common Stock through a restricted stock unit (RSU) award, scheduled to vest in ratable installments over a two-year period from the grant date.
- Disposed of 2,080 shares of Common Stock at a price of $58.38 per share, which were withheld to cover taxes related to the vesting of restricted stock units.
- Acquired 10,278 performance-based restricted stock units, with the actual number of shares earned potentially varying from zero to two times the target, based on performance during the period from January 1, 2026, to December 31, 2028.
- Following these transactions, Stephen J. Beaver beneficially owns 100,367 shares of Common Stock directly and 20,556 performance-based restricted stock units directly.

Future Outlook
The filing indicates future vesting schedules for restricted stock units over two and three-year periods from the grant date. Additionally, performance-based restricted stock units have a performance period from January 1, 2026, to December 31, 2028, with the final number of shares to be determined and issued by March 15, 2029.
